Creating Your Very Own Feature Wall

Having a feature wall in the home is a must if you want to add some character and personality. The good news is, you don’t need a professional painter/decorator to do this for you. There are so many ways you can do it all on your own. You could simply use a bold color that stands out against everything else, or a roll of nice patterned paper. However, you can be as creative as you like. Some people choose to paint their own mural or put up some artwork.

 

The key to creating a feature wall is to make sure you choose the right wall. It should be a plain wall, with nothing distracting on it, such as a window or door. It should also draw the eye nicely when a person enters the room. Having one or two of these in the home can be a great way to make it your own.

Using Accessories The Right Way

You need to make sure you’re using accessories the right way in your home decor. You don’t want your home to look visually cluttered up, so don’t use too many little figurines and things. Choose wisely. You can even choose something larger, to replace many small accessories. This will give a cleaner look while still adding to the overall feel of a room. There are certain accessories you can layer, however, such as your pillows and throws. This way, you can make sure you’re incorporating lots of texture which will stop your home from looking dull.

 

Coming Up With Your Color Scheme

Coming up with your color scheme can be hard work. You want something that will last for years, and you don’t want to get bored. If you’re going for brighter colors, you can use a color wheel to figure out what colors are complementary, and what colors contrast best. Contrasting colors in a room can look incredible, such as teal and orange!
